The Evolution of Home Cleaning: Robotic Hoover and Mop Systems

In the ever-evolving landscape of home innovation, one of the most substantial improvements has been the advancement of robotic hoover and mop systems. These smart gadgets have changed the mundane task of cleaning into a smooth, efficient, and nearly effortless procedure. This post looks into the world of robotic hoover and mop systems, exploring their functions, benefits, and the technology that powers them.

Introduction to Robotic Hoover and Mop Systems

Robotic hoover and mop systems are autonomous cleaning gadgets designed to keep the cleanliness of homes and offices. These gadgets utilize innovative robotics, expert system (AI), and sensing unit innovation to navigate and clean floorings, carpets, and tough surfaces. Unlike traditional vacuum cleaners and mops, robotic systems can run individually, scheduling cleaning tasks and changing their behavior based upon the environment and user preferences.

Secret Features of Robotic Hoover and Mop Systems

  1. Autonomous Navigation

    • Laser Mapping: Many high-end designs utilize laser navigation to develop an in-depth map of the home environment. This allows the robot to prepare its cleaning route effectively and prevent obstacles.
    • Vision Sensors: Some models are geared up with cameras and vision sensing units to find and browse around challenges, guaranteeing that they don't get stuck or damage furnishings.
    • Edge Detection: To prevent falls, these robotics utilize edge detection sensors that stop them from cleaning near stairs or other drop-offs.
  2. Cleaning Capabilities

    • HEPA Filters: High-efficiency particle air (HEPA) filters capture great dust and allergens, making these devices ideal for homes with animals or allergy patients.
    • Numerous Cleaning Modes: Most robotic hoovers and mops provide different cleaning modes, such as spot cleaning, edge cleaning, and deep cleaning, to resolve different cleaning needs.
    • Mop and Vacuum Combination: Some designs integrate vacuuming and mopping in one gadget, conserving time and effort by performing both tasks all at once.
  3. Smart Technology Integration

    • Voice Control: Integration with smart home systems like Amazon Alexa, Google Assistant, and Apple HomeKit enables users to control the robot vacuum cleaners reviews with voice commands.
    • App Control: Users can set up cleaning, keep an eye on the robot's status, and get notices through committed mobile apps.
    • Automated Charging: When the battery is low, the robot go back to its charging dock automatically, guaranteeing it is always prepared for the next cleaning session.
  4. User-Friendly Design

    • Compact Size: Robotic hoovers and mops are designed to fit under furniture and in tight areas, making them perfect for small homes or cluttered rooms.
    • Low Noise: Many designs are designed to operate silently, reducing disturbance to daily activities.
    • Eco-Friendly: Some robotics are energy-efficient and usage water and cleaning solutions sparingly, making them an ecologically mindful option.

How Robotic Hoover and Mop Systems Work

  1. Mapping and Navigation

    • Initial Mapping: Upon setup, the robot develops a map of the home using its sensing units. This map is then kept in its memory for future reference.
    • Path Planning: Using the map, the robot plans its cleaning route, ensuring it covers all locations efficiently.
    • Barrier Avoidance: Advanced sensors and algorithms assist the robot identify and avoid obstacles, preventing damage to furnishings and itself.
  2. Cleaning Process

    • Vacuuming: The robot utilizes a mix of brushes and suction to eliminate dust, dirt, and particles from floors and carpets.
    • Mopping: For hard surfaces, the robot dispenses water and cleaning option, then uses a microfiber pad to mop the floor.
    • Self-Cleaning: Some models include self-cleaning brushes and filters, minimizing the need for manual maintenance.
  3. Maintenance and Care

    • Filter Cleaning: Regular cleaning of the HEPA filter is necessary to preserve the robot's performance.
    • Water Reservoir: For mopping models, the water reservoir requires to be refilled and emptied as needed.
    • Software Updates: Keeping the robot's software application up to date ensures it operates at its best and can take advantage of new functions and improvements.

Popular Models and Brands

  1. iRobot Roomba and Braava

    • Roomba: Known for its advanced navigation and cleaning abilities, the Roomba series includes designs with numerous features, such as Wi-Fi connectivity and voice control.
    • Braava: Specialized in mopping, the Braava series uses different mopping strategies, including sweeping and scrubbing, to clean up tough floorings successfully.
  2. Ecovacs Deebot

    • Deebot OZMO: This model integrates vacuuming and mopping, with advanced navigation and smart home combination.
    • Deebot T8: Features a powerful suction system and a big water tank for deep cleaning.
  3. Neato Robotics

    • D7 Connected: Known for its D-shaped style, which permits better cleaning in corners, the D7 Connected deals advanced mapping and navigation.
  4. Xiaomi

    • Mi Robot Vacuum-Mop: An economical option that integrates vacuum and mopping functions, with smart navigation and app control.

Frequently Asked Questions (FAQs)

  1. Q: Are robotic hoovers and mops appropriate for pet owners?

    • A: Yes, lots of models are specifically designed with animals in mind. They feature effective suction, HEPA filters to catch pet hair and irritants, and durable brushes that can deal with pet messes.
  2. Q: Can these robots tidy stairs?

    • A: Most robotic hoovers and mops are not designed to clean stairs due to the risk of damage. However, some designs have edge detection sensing units that prevent them from falling off stairs.
  3. Q: How frequently do I need to clean the robot's filter and brushes?

    • A: It is recommended to clean the filter and brushes after each usage, especially if there is a lot of pet hair or particles. This guarantees optimum efficiency and durability of the device.
  4. Q: Can I manage the robot from my mobile phone?

    • A: Yes, numerous designs come with devoted mobile apps that allow users to control the robot, schedule cleaning sessions, and monitor its status from anywhere.
  5. Q: How do I set up a robotic hoover or mop?

    • A: Setup usually includes charging the robot, downloading the mobile app, and developing a map of the home environment. Some designs likewise need Wi-Fi connection for innovative features.
  6. Q: Are these robots environmentally friendly?

    • A: Many designs are designed to be energy-efficient and use water and cleaning solutions sparingly, making them an eco-friendly option for home cleaning.

Extra Tips for Optimal Use

  • Clear the Floor: Before scheduling a cleaning session, clear the floor of any small items that may disrupt the robot's operation.
  • Routine Maintenance: Clean the filters and brushes regularly to guarantee the robot carries out at its best automatic vacuum cleaner.
  • Update Software: Keep the robot's software application upgraded to benefit from the newest functions and improvements.
  • Explore Settings: Try various cleaning modes and schedules to find the very best setup for your home.
